Workforce Foresighting Hub Podcast
Due to the speed of innovation, UK organisations need a workforce able to adapt to new capabilities that require different and often higher skill sets. New recruits with the right skills are often in short supply. Failure to address this ongoing challenge could mean the UK misses out on opportunities to take market-leading positions and become competitive on a global scale.
The Workforce Foresighting Hub has been set up to address this challenge and provide insights and recommendations that will help identify and prepare for future skill demands.
In this informative new series, the Workforce Foresighting Hub Podcast brings together coaches, educators, employers, technologists, and conveners from the Catapult Network. We will discuss how we can work together to address the skills challenge, how the Workforce Foresighting Hub works, and what can be done to ensure UK organisations have a skilled workforce ready to adapt to new capabilities aligned with emerging technology and innovation.
